Output 839cb33f721c441da03acb7569cce2194fd2b556cb1999597a91e379a03cb7c2:0

value
8709573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aac196e31959c73ddb3bc06ff71bd614781f73f9 OP_EQUAL
address
3HFthywB12J3tfAJQSSrNhxrnDjJt5BD3b
transaction
839cb33f721c441da03acb7569cce2194fd2b556cb1999597a91e379a03cb7c2
confirmations
340682
spent
true